[Lazarus-es] Views y Stored Procedures

Edwin Quijada listas_quijada en hotmail.com
Mie Jun 24 23:44:02 CEST 2009


Yo uso todo en la BD mientars mas cosas pueda meter en la BD mejor.
Tanto asi que mis forms los botones de salvar solo tienen 10 lineas.



*-------------------------------------------------------*
*-Edwin Quijada
*-Developer DataBase
*-JQ Microsistemas

*-Soporte PostgreSQL

*-www.jqmicrosistemas.com
*-809-849-8087
*-------------------------------------------------------*







----------------------------------------
> Date: Wed, 24 Jun 2009 16:47:22 +0200
> From: joshyfun en gmail.com
> To: lazarus-es en lists.lazarus.freepascal.org
> Subject: Re: [Lazarus-es] Views y Stored Procedures
>
> Hello Giuseppe,
>
> Wednesday, June 24, 2009, 3:34:53 PM, you wrote:
>
> GLPR> Los que trabajáis en Firebird. Dejáis toda la lógica de los datos en
> GLPR> la BBDD?
> GLPR> Es decir, para los campos autonuméricos un trigger, para un campo
> GLPR> total en la cabecera de factura, un trigger que lo actualice al
> GLPR> insertar una linea en la tabla de lineas, lo mismo para descontar de
> GLPR> stockage por ejemplo y demás.
> GLPR> Dejando sólo para la aplicación, aquellos que no se pueda hacer
> GLPR> directamente sobre la BBDD.
>
> Yo dejo en la BBDD todo lo que se refiere a integridad de los datos
> (triggers, borrados y updates en cascada, etc) pero el resto intento
> mantenerlo en programa a menos que no se pueda o no sea viable por
> rendimiento. Claro que yo no trabajo con cosas como facturaciones,
> control de almacenes, etc... de hecho con RDBMS sólo he hecho una cosa
> de esas :) y pequeña, muy pequeña.
>
> Aunque reconozco que lo lógico sería pasar cuantas más reglas de
> negociación a la BBDD como sea posible.
>
> --
> Best regards,
> JoshyFun
>
>
> _______________________________________________
> Lazarus-es mailing list
> Lazarus-es en lists.lazarus.freepascal.org
> http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es
_________________________________________________________________
Windows Live Hotmail now works up to 70% faster.
http://windowslive.com/Explore/Hotmail?ocid=TXT_TAGLM_WL_hotmail_acq_faster_112008



More information about the Lazarus-es mailing list